Transaction 33ab1ee045791324caa8deb54b566e9cf9ad52c011753ef09ab617d3390c0de2
1 Input
1 Output
-
33ab1ee045791324caa8deb54b566e9cf9ad52c011753ef09ab617d3390c0de2:0
- value
- 21852473
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d44796c96ea1bd9ae7ef0e26320f7da9bd80d76
- address
- ltc1q94z8jmykagdantn77r3xxg8hm2dasrtkudnxzt